Sharp rise in criminal cases among minors

Knesset Research and Information Center reports a rise in juvenile criminal cases in 2024/25, with over 6,800 criminal cases opened against minors in the past year.

Judge compared illegal residents to Jews in the Holocaust

A Juvenile Court judge sparked controversy after comparing underage illegal residents of Israel to Jews in the Holocaust, during a hearing in which he decided not to convict them or impose a sentence.

14-year-old indicted for espionage

Prosecutor's Office files indictment against 14-year-old boy who filmed sensitive sites, carried out security-related tasks on behalf of Iranian agent.
